Jersey Mike's Stock Falls 3% in Debut After IPO Priced at $23

Jersey Mike's shares fell 3% in their first day of trading on the stock market, after the sandwich chain priced its initial public offering at $23 per share. The stock opened lower and remained under pressure throughout the session, reflecting a mixed reception from investors. The IPO raised capital for the company as it seeks to expand its footprint.

CEO Charlie Morrison addressed the trading debut and other topics in a television interview. He discussed the company's supply chain and ongoing demand growth, as well as an outbreak of cyclospora—a parasitic infection linked to produce—that has affected some customers. Morrison emphasized that the company is taking steps to address the situation.

The debut follows a period of strong growth for Jersey Mike's, which has been expanding its store count and menu offerings. The stock's decline on the first day suggests some caution among investors, though the company remains focused on long-term expansion.

The IPO was one of the most anticipated in the restaurant sector this year. With the proceeds, Jersey Mike's plans to open new locations and invest in its digital infrastructure. The company did not provide specific guidance on future performance.
